Welshpool 10K
The Welshpool 10k is an annual road running event held in the town of Welshpool, UK. Organized by Adrenaline Sporting Events, the race starts and finishes in the town centre at Broad Street. The route is a single-lap course that transitions from the town through local lanes and the surrounding countryside.
The course is widely noted for its undulating profile, featuring several significant hill sections. Approximately the first part of the race contains the majority of the climbing, while the final 2 km segment offers a descent through the grounds of Powis Castle leading back into the town. Participants run on traffic-free roads with established closures and clear marshalling throughout the route.
The event includes several features for participants:
- 10 km distance
- Bespoke finisher's medal
- On-course water stations using cups
- Course marshals and cycle marshals
The race location is approximately 52.66°N, -3.15°W. Previous editions have featured local support from spectators within the town and along the scenic sections near the castle estate. Facilities traditionally include a goody bag for finishers and local parking options, though participants are advised to arrive early to manage parking requirements.
